Bandrauk, Emmanuel Lorin, Francois Fillion-Gourdeau","submitted_at":"2011-07-23T02:41:56Z","abstract_excerpt":"The validation and parallel implementation of a numerical method for the solution of the time-dependent Dirac equation is presented. This numerical method is based on a split operator scheme where the space-time dependence is computed in coordinate space using the method of characteristics. Thus, most of the steps in the splitting are calculated exactly, making for a very efficient and unconditionally stable method. We show that it is free from spurious solutions related to the fermion-doubling problem and that it can be parallelized very efficiently.
